• Home
  • Architecture
  • Samples
  • Setup
  • Debugging
  • API
  • Automation
  • API

    Show / Hide Table of Contents

    Class SpatialAnchorsLocalizer

    This is the localization mechanism for enabling anchor exchange/localization through Azure Spatial Anchors.

    Inheritance
    Object
    SpatialLocalizer<SpatialAnchorsConfiguration>
    SpatialAnchorsLocalizer
    Implements
    ISpatialLocalizer
    Inherited Members
    SpatialLocalizer<SpatialAnchorsConfiguration>.lockObject
    SpatialLocalizer<SpatialAnchorsConfiguration>.debugLogging
    SpatialLocalizer<SpatialAnchorsConfiguration>.DebugLog(String)
    SpatialLocalizer<SpatialAnchorsConfiguration>.Start()
    SpatialLocalizer<SpatialAnchorsConfiguration>.OnDestroy()
    SpatialLocalizer<SpatialAnchorsConfiguration>.CreateDefaultSettings()
    SpatialLocalizer<SpatialAnchorsConfiguration>.ISpatialLocalizer.TryDeserializeSettings(BinaryReader, ISpatialLocalizationSettings)
    SpatialLocalizer<SpatialAnchorsConfiguration>.ISpatialLocalizer.TryCreateLocalizationSession(IPeerConnection, ISpatialLocalizationSettings, ISpatialLocalizationSession)
    Namespace: Microsoft.MixedReality.SpectatorView
    Assembly: cs.temp.dll.dll
    Syntax
    public class SpatialAnchorsLocalizer : SpatialLocalizer<SpatialAnchorsConfiguration>, ISpatialLocalizer

    Properties

    DisplayName

    Declaration
    public override string DisplayName { get; }
    Property Value
    Type Description
    String
    Overrides
    Microsoft.MixedReality.SpectatorView.SpatialLocalizer<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ration>.DisplayName

    IsSupported

    Declaration
    protected override bool IsSupported { get; }
    Property Value
    Type Description
    Boolean
    Overrides
    Microsoft.MixedReality.SpectatorView.SpatialLocalizer<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ration>.IsSupported

    SpatialLocalizerId

    Declaration
    public override Guid SpatialLocalizerId { get; }
    Property Value
    Type Description
    Guid
    Overrides
    Microsoft.MixedReality.SpectatorView.SpatialLocalizer<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ration>.SpatialLocalizerId

    Methods

    TryCreateLocalizationSession(IPeerConnection, SpatialAnchorsConfiguration, out ISpatialLocalizationSession)

    Declaration
    public override bool TryCreateLocalizationSession(IPeerConnection peerConnection, SpatialAnchorsConfiguration settings, out ISpatialLocalizationSession session)
    Parameters
    Type Name Description
    IPeerConnection peerConnection
    SpatialAnchorsConfiguration settings
    ISpatialLocalizationSession session
    Returns
    Type Description
    Boolean
    Overrides
    Microsoft.MixedReality.SpectatorView.SpatialLocalizer<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ration>.TryCreateLocalizationSession(Microsoft.MixedReality.SpectatorView.IPeerConnection,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ration, Microsoft.MixedReality.SpectatorView.ISpatialLocalizationSession)

    TryDeserializeSettings(BinaryReader, out SpatialAnchorsConfiguration)

    Declaration
    public override bool TryDeserializeSettings(BinaryReader reader, out SpatialAnchorsConfiguration settings)
    Parameters
    Type Name Description
    BinaryReader reader
    SpatialAnchorsConfiguration settings
    Returns
    Type Description
    Boolean
    Overrides
    Microsoft.MixedReality.SpectatorView.SpatialLocalizer<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ration>.TryDeserializeSettings(BinaryReader, Microsoft.MixedReality.SpectatorView.SpatialAnchorsConfiguration)

    Implements

    ISpatialLocalizer
    In This Article
    • Properties
      • DisplayName
      • IsSupported
      • SpatialLocalizerId
    • Methods
      • TryCreateLocalizationSession(IPeerConnection, SpatialAnchorsConfiguration, out ISpatialLocalizationSession)
      • TryDeserializeSettings(BinaryReader, out SpatialAnchorsConfiguration)
    • Implements
    Back to top Generated by DocFX